The Gallery Hotel is a Victorian 4-star boutique hotel offering you an ambience of the Victorian era but giving you amenities of the modern world. There's a genuinely warm feeling of welcome in the mahogany panelled reception, lobby and lounge - the latter replete with original artworks, an imposing Jacobean Revival chimney piece, plump sofas and discreet bar.
The Gallery Hotel has 34 guest rooms with an en suite bathroom and shower. The 2 master suites, Rossetti and Leighton, are furnished with the individuality and refinement befitting their names. Each has its own roof terrace, jacuzzi bath, and CD/DVD player provided.

Transport
By London Underground:
The nearest London Underground station is South Kensington, which is on the Circle Line (yellow), the District Line (green) and the Piccadilly Line (dark blue).
The hotel is just 2 minutes walk from the station. The Tube stations of Kensington, Knightsbridge, Sloane Square and Earls Court are also within easy walking distance.
